Refactor to a more convenient internal API

This commit is contained in:
Andreas Hocevar
2016-06-22 23:41:00 +02:00
parent cf7ff841a7
commit 6b4ee42c90
34 changed files with 497 additions and 554 deletions

View File

@@ -1,6 +1,6 @@
goog.provide('ol.render');
goog.require('ol.matrix');
goog.require('ol.transform');
goog.require('ol.render.canvas.Immediate');
@@ -36,8 +36,7 @@ ol.render.toContext = function(context, opt_options) {
canvas.style.height = size[1] + 'px';
}
var extent = [0, 0, canvas.width, canvas.height];
var transform = ol.matrix.makeTransform(ol.matrix.create(),
0, 0, pixelRatio, pixelRatio, 0, 0, 0);
var transform = ol.transform.scale(ol.transform.create(), pixelRatio, pixelRatio);
return new ol.render.canvas.Immediate(context, pixelRatio, extent, transform,
0);
};